Beed Custard Apple

Download

Beed Custard Apple, cultivated in the Balaghat ranges of Maharashtra, is a premium dryland fruit known for its exceptional sweetness and creamy pulp. Grown in shallow, gravelly, potassium-rich soils, it features a round shape, shiny green skin and soft granular flesh. The fruit is harvested manually and consumed fresh or processed.
